1. Use a Strong, Unique Password
The first step in secure login practices is creating a strong and unique password. Don’t use common or easy-to-guess passwords like “123456,” “password,” or your name. Instead, follow these tips:
- Use a mix of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ters.
- Avoid using personal information like birthdays or pet names.
- Use a different password for each online account you have.
Example of a strong password: C0ca!neSpin#2025
Bonus Tip: Use a password manager to store and manage all your passwords securely. It helps you generate strong passwords and auto-fill them when needed.
2.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)
Two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of security. Even if someone gets your password, they still won’t be able to log in without the second step.
Cocainespin supports 2FA, and enabling it is highly recommended. Here’s how it works:
- You enter your password.
- You get a code on your phone or email.
- You enter the code to complete the login.
This way, even if hackers guess your password, they can’t log in without your phone.

4. Watch Out for Phishing Scams
Phishing is a trick hackers use to steal your login details. They send fake emails or create fake websites that look like Cocainespin.
To avoid phishing:
- Always check the website URL before logging in. It should start with “https://” and be spelled correctly.
- Don’t click on links in emails unless you’re sure they’re safe.
- If you receive a suspicious email, report it to Cocainespin support.
5. Log Out After Each Session
Especially if you’re using a shared or public device, always log out when you’re done. This prevents anyone else from accessing your account.
Also, avoid clicking the “remember me” option on public computers. This might save your password for the next user.
6. Update Your Software and Browser
Hackers often use security holes in outdated software or browsers to attack users. That’s why it’s important to:
- Keep your device’s operating system updated.
- Use the latest version of your web browser.
- Install trusted antivirus and anti-malware software.
These updates often include important security patches that protect you while using Cocainespin and other websites.
